A TV themed attraction at Salford Quays has closed just over a year after it was set up.

The I’m a Celebrity... Jungle Challenge has closed its doors ‘with immediate affect’ after ITV bosses said the attraction was “financially unviable going forward.” The themed interactive attraction was inspired by the Bushtucker trials on the ITV reality show, offering teams of visitors a series of challenges to complete, and was based at the Quayside (formerly Lowry centre). It was advertising for customers on its Facebook page just a few days ago during the busy half-term holidays.

However, today it revealed it was to close and has promised refunds to people who have already booked. In a statement on its website and Facebook page, operators said: “ITV has made the decision to close the IAC Jungle Challenge Attraction with immediate effect.

“All customers with future bookings will be automatically contacted via the booking email and fully refunded. Please allow 7 working days for the team to process your refund and for the money to appear back in your bank account.”

An ITV spokesman told ManchesterWorld: “ITV have made the decision to close the IAC Jungle Challenge Attraction as it has become financially unviable going forward.

“We’d like to express our thanks to the staff at our operator Continuum for their work during the time it has been open.

“Where practical we will seek to redeploy team members across our other attractions operated by Continuum.”

The closure comes as ITV announces contestants for the new series of the jungle based show. Competitors include MP Matt Hancock, DJ Chris Moyles and Manchester-based footballer Jill Scott. The 22nd series will start on Sunday 6 November at 9pm on ITV1.
